Surgical Innovations for Penile Length and Girth Enhancement

What modern surgical techniques exist to increase penile girth and length?

Several contemporary surgical methods aim to augment penile size, addressing both length and girth. These include ligamentolysis, which involves cutting the suspensory ligament to allow the flaccid penis to hang lower, creating the appearance of increased length. Other lengthening procedures, such as V-Y advancement flaps and penile disassembly, reconstruct penile tissues to achieve true elongation.

For girth enhancement, the Penuma® implant, an FDA-cleared soft silicone device, is surgically placed beneath the penile skin to increase circumference and length. The implant typically increases girth from about 8.5 cm to 13.4 cm and length from around 9.1 cm to 11.3 cm based on clinical studies.

Newer techniques like the tunica expansion technique (TEP) present promising advances. TEP involves making small, staggered incisions on the tunica albuginea via a single scrotal incision, allowing for controlled expansion of the corpora cavernosa. This method enables simultaneous enhancements in both length and girth while preserving penile function and reducing risks associated with more invasive surgery.

What are the risks associated with penile girth enhancement surgery?

Surgical penile enhancement carries several risks, requiring careful patient evaluation. Common complications include infection, scarring, penile deformity, loss of sensation, and erectile dysfunction. Specifically, Penuma® implant insertion can lead to complications such as seroma formation, capsular contracture, wound infections, and rarely, device perforation.

Patient dissatisfaction due to cosmetic or functional outcomes has also been reported, alongside possible serious adverse events warranting device removal. The infection rates reported vary, with some centers noting rates as low as less than 1%, which is below the national average of 1-5%, illustrating the importance of experienced surgical teams.

What does recovery entail and how long are procedures?

Procedures such as TEP and Penuma implantation generally take between 45 minutes to 3 hours. The TEP surgery typically lasts 2-3 hours, is often done on an outpatient basis, and patients are discharged the same day.

Recovery involves managing pain, infection prevention, and avoiding sexual activity for several weeks. Drains may be removed 2-3 days post-surgery, and full recovery often spans 4-6 weeks. FDA stance and clinical guidelines on penile augmentation

The American Urological Association (AUA) maintains a cautious position regarding Penile Augmentation Surgery. Notably, it regards subcutaneous fat injections for girth enhancement and division of the suspensory ligament for lengthening as unsafe and ineffective, reaffirmed as recently as 2018. Currently, no FDA-approved devices or extensively validated surgical techniques exist specifically for penile girth enhancement, emphasizing the experimental nature of most procedures. This regulatory stance underscores the necessity for evidence-based, risk-conscious approaches.

Understanding Penile Growth and Patient Profiles

At what age does penile growth typically begin and end?

Penile growth generally initiates during puberty, which occurs between 10 and 14 years of age. Most males reach their adult penile size by approximately 18 to 19 years old, although some minor growth may continue into the early twenties. This development is primarily influenced by hormonal changes, especially the surge of testosterone during adolescence (penile elongation surgery review).

Typical age range and hormonal influence for penile growth

Penile size increases rapidly during puberty, driven largely by testosterone and other androgens. Hormone levels stimulate tissue growth in the corpora cavernosa and surrounding structures, shaping both length and girth. In cases of true micropenis, where growth is significantly restricted, hormonal therapy with exogenous testosterone during early childhood may promote size increase (penile elongation surgery review.

Variability due to genetics and health

Beyond hormones, penile size is influenced by genetic factors and overall health. These genetic and physiological differences explain the natural variability in penile dimensions among men. Most men fall within typical size ranges, with average erect length around 13.12 cm and girth about 11.66 cm (male penile enhancement procedures).

Clinical measurement standards (SPL)

Stretched Penile Length (SPL) is the established measurement standard closely approximating erect length, used in clinical settings to assess size accurately. SPL measurement helps diagnose conditions like micropenis (defined as SPL below two standard deviations of the mean) (penile elongation surgery review.

Distinguishing medical indications from cosmetic desires

Medical indications for penile enlargement are rare and usually relate to congenital or acquired conditions such as micropenis or buried penis, where functionality and urination may be compromised. Most requests for penile enhancement are cosmetic, emphasizing the importance of thorough patient counseling on realistic expectations, risks, and benefits (Penis enlargement surgery).

Medical Management of Erectile Dysfunction: A Complement to Enhancement Procedures

What is the best medical treatment for male erectile dysfunction?

The most effective medical treatment for male erectile dysfunction (ED) are phosphodiesterase type 5 (PDE5) inhibitors, including commonly prescribed drugs such as Viagra, Cialis, and Levitra. These medications work by increasing blood flow to the penis, thereby facilitating the ability to achieve and maintain an erection suitable for sexual activity.

Overview of PDE5 inhibitors (Viagra, Cialis, Levitra) as primary erectile dysfunction treatment

PDE5 inhibitors are the primary pharmacological option for treating ED and have been widely studied and proven effective. They act by relaxing smooth muscle tissue and dilating blood vessels in the penis, enhancing erectile function without altering penile size or girth. Treatment with these agents is generally well tolerated with mild side effects.

Differences between size enhancement and erectile dysfunction therapies

It is important to distinguish between Penis enlargement surgery procedures and ED treatments. While medical male enhancement procedures focus on altering physical dimensions for aesthetic or psychological benefits, PDE5 inhibitors address the functional aspect of erectile quality rather than size. Enhancement techniques may improve confidence and perceived sexual satisfaction but do not directly treat erectile difficulties.
